Javascript 如果在Jquery的droppable中删除了Dragable,如何设置结果?

Javascript 如果在Jquery的droppable中删除了Dragable,如何设置结果?,javascript,jquery,html,css,jquery-ui,Javascript,Jquery,Html,Css,Jquery Ui,我试图增加计数器的值(var counter=0;),如果屏幕上的可拖动图像被放入dropzone(也是图像,而不是div) 这段代码只是在可拖放文件被拖放到图像上后淡出。在它消失之前/之后,我想将计数器增加1 注意:#goldbag和#jack2都是单个容器div中的图像(),您可以扩展drop回调函数。 $( "#goldbag" ).draggable({ revert: "invalid", containment: "parent" }); $( "#jack2" ).droppabl

我试图增加计数器的值(
var counter=0;
),如果屏幕上的可拖动图像被放入dropzone(也是图像,而不是
div

这段代码只是在可拖放文件被拖放到图像上后淡出。在它消失之前/之后,我想将计数器增加1


注意:
#goldbag
#jack2
都是单个容器
div
中的图像(
),您可以扩展
drop
回调函数。
$( "#goldbag" ).draggable({ revert: "invalid", containment: "parent" });
$( "#jack2" ).droppable({
    drop: function(event, ui) {
        draggedObj = ui.draggable.attr('id'); 
        $("#"+draggedObj).fadeOut(function() { $(this).remove(); });
        $( "img" ).draggable({ disabled: true });
    }
});
下面是一个过于简化的示例,您可以在增加计数器的同时多次拖放同一项

此代码大部分取自以下文档:

$(函数(){
var$计数器=$(“#计数器”);
var计数=0;
$(“#可拖动”).draggable();
$(“#可拖放”)。可拖放({
drop:函数(事件、用户界面){
$(本)
.addClass(“ui状态突出显示”)
.查找(“p”)
.html(“已删除!”);
计数++;
$counter.html(count);
}
});
});
#可拖动{
宽度:100px;
高度:100px;
填充:0.5em;
浮动:左;
保证金:10px 10px 10px 0;
}
#可降落{
宽度:150px;
高度:150像素;
填充:0.5em;
浮动:左;
利润率:10px;
}

把我拖到我的目标

到这里来

柜台:0